Painkiller Patches Cause Prescription Drug Addiction and Overdose

September 23, 2008

Duragesic, a painkiller patch containing Fentanyl, an addictive opioid painkiller similar to heroin, has been recalled again last month - for the fourth time this year. And there were several before that. The 2005 recall of Duragesic followed the death of 120 people. You’d think that with the deaths and the potential for prescription drug addiction, the product would be taken off the market.

Instead, the manufacturer is going through one lawsuit after another. Recent news articles say there are hundreds of lawsuits pending. It was the same story a few years ago – hundreds of lawsuits pending. All told, with at least five recalls over the years, I’m sure the lawsuits number in the thousands.

When you realize how many millions are paid out in lawsuits you get an idea of just how profitable these types of drugs really are.

Overdose, death and prescription drug addiction are not the only side effects of Duragesic. It can also cause damage to the cardiovascular and nervous systems.

Duragesic is also often prescribed off-label. It’s approved for very severe pain, like that of cancer, that is not relieved by any other painkiller. Instead, it’s given to people with  moderate pain – which may well have been alleviated by other  means. Instead, both the doctors and the patients are risking damage, prescription drug addiction and death. A high price to pay for a little relief from moderate pain.

Duragesic is not the only painkiller causing these problems.
